Biography

Mark M. Tehranipoor is the dean for the Herbert Wertheim College of Engineering, a UF Distinguished Professor and the Intel Charles E. Young Preeminence Endowed Chair Professor in Cybersecurity. Prior to being named dean, he was the Sachio Semmoto Chair in the UF Department of Electrical & Computer Engineering.

An internationally recognized cyber/hardware security expert and accomplished academic leader, Tehranipoor has built a distinguished career advancing research innovation, forging strategic partnerships and creating opportunities through years of leadership and scholarly accomplishments at the University of Florida. Tehranipoor is a proven, long-time leader at the college. As founder of the Florida Semiconductor Institute, founding director of UF’s Florida Institute for Cybersecurity Research, and co-director for the National Microelectronic Security Training Center, he plays a pivotal role in shaping the nation’s secure electronics ecosystem. 

He is also a fellow of the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ers, the National Academy of Inventors, the Association for Computing Machinery, the International Academy of Artificial Intelligence Sciences, the International Artificial Intelligence Industry Alliance, and the Academy of Science, Engineering and Medicine of Florida. Tehranipoor has published 700 journal articles and refereed conference papers, and has delivered more than 250 invited talks and keynote addresses. In addition, he has 26 patents issued, 27 pending invention disclosures and has published 20 books, of which two are textbooks. His projects have been sponsored by more than 60 companies and government agencies.
